Ingredients:

6 eggs

-1/4 cup of milk

- 2 small potatoes peeled and diced

- 1 green onion

- 6 chicken breakfast sausages @amylufoods

- 1/3 cup of goat cheese

- 1 Tbsp of extra virgin olive oil

- Salt, pepper and smoked paprika to taste

-Green onions for garnish


You may remove the potatoes to keep them keto and low carb. You may change the cheese if you wish with cheddar or mozarela. Just add the cheese of your choice.

Instructions

First: sautee the potatoes, sausages and onions for about 8 min, season with salt and pepper.
In the meantime, grease a muffin tin with avocado oil.
In a bowl crack open each egg and whisk them, add seasoning to taste with salt, pepper & a couple of pinches of smoked paprika .
Add a spoonful of the potato sausage mix to each muffin hole, add the goat cheese and top off with egg mixture.
Bake at 375 for about 20 minutes.
Tips
  • Tip I I used a tray with water to place my muffin tin on top to prevent from burning at the bottom and keeps them fluffy.
